Company

48North Cannabis Corp. (TSXV:NRTH) is the publicly-traded parent company of two federally-licensed producers and distributors of cannabis and cannabis products for the adult-use market in Canada pursuant to the Cannabis Act; DelShen Therapeutics and Good & Green.

The Company operates three facilities in Ontario:

  • DelShen - a 40,000 sq. ft. indoor facility on 800 acres near Kirkland Lake;
  • Good House - a 46,000 sq. ft. indoor facility on 3.5 acres in Brantford; and
  • Good Farm - a 100-acre organic farm in Brant County.

48North has a multi-channel distribution strategy that includes supply agreements with Canopy Growth Corp. and the provincial distribution agencies of Ontario and Quebec.

VP of Human Resources

Poised for rapid growth at Good House and Good Farm, the Company is seeking an experienced HR professional for the newly formed position of VP of Human Resources.

Reporting to the co-CEOs and located full-time at Good House in Brantford, Ontario, the VP of Human Resources will direct all HR activities across the organization, including optimizing organizational structure, developing HR policies, setting remuneration strategies and leading recruitment activities. This position will play a key role in policy creation, recruitment, performance management and employee relations as well as analyzing HR trends. The ideal candidate will have strong experience as a senior HR professional, sound judgment and strong interpersonal skills, along with comprehensive knowledge and experience in Canadian legislation for both Human Resources and Health & Safety.
